Tool Shop Limited Overview
Tool Shop Limited is a live company located in glasgow, G3 7QL with a Companies House number of SC533634. It operates in the other retail sale in non-specialised stores sector, SIC Code 47190. Founded in April 2016, it's largest shareholder is robert williams with a 40% stake. Tool Shop Limited is a young, small sized company, Pomanda has estimated its turnover at £779.5k with declining growth in recent years.
